The Role of Intellectual Property Documents in Global Commerce

Intellectual Property (IP) documents are the cornerstone of safeguarding innovation and establishing a competitive edge in global commerce. For businesses in the UK, the strategic translation of these documents is paramount for several reasons. Firstly, IP rights are territorial, meaning that protections are granted by individual countries according to their own laws. To ensure that UK businesses can fully leverage their IP internationally, accurate translations of patents, trademarks, and copyright registrations are essential. This enables companies not only to enforce their rights but also to engage in licensing agreements and collaborative ventures with global partners.
Secondly, the process of securing IP rights abroad involves navigating complex legal frameworks and local regulations. UK translation services specialising in intellectual property documents provide the expertise necessary to accurately convey the nuances of these legal instruments. By ensuring that the content is both legally precise and culturally appropriate, businesses can avoid misunderstandings and legal pitfalls that may arise from mistranslations or omissions. This precision is critical for maintaining the integrity of IP rights and for effectively asserting a company’s market position on an international scale.

Common Challenges and Pitfalls in Translating Intellectual Property Documents

Intellectual Property (IP) documents are critical for safeguarding inventions, designs, and trademarks that form the backbone of a business’s competitive edge. Translating these documents into different languages presents unique challenges that go beyond mere word-for-word conversion. The nuances within IP language often necessitate a deep understanding of both the source and target linguistic contexts, as well as the specific technical lexicon employed in IP law. UK translation services must be adept at navigating these intricacies to avoid misinterpretations that could lead to legal disputes or loss of proprietary rights. A common pitfall is the reliance on machine translations which can overlook context-specific terminology and the finer points of language, potentially resulting in errors that compromise the integrity of the IP documentation. Moreover, cultural sensitivities and legal differences must be considered to ensure that the translation accurately reflects the original document’s intent and meaning. Expert translators with specialized knowledge in both IP law and the target language are indispensable for overcoming these hurdles, ensuring that UK businesses can confidently expand their operations internationally while maintaining the full force and effect of their intellectual property rights.
